My expertise in studio art is drawing. My artwork is not what one generally may expect from a cancer fighter/survivor; it is simplistic, imaginative and, dare I say
happy!
Each piece begins with a hand crafted wood panel. Using oil paints, I glaze the wood to allow the natural patterns to show through. Appropriately, these grains, made from water, become water-like designs for the setting of each composition. Once dry, the fish-creatures are freehand drawn with colored pencil atop the oil-glazed wood. Some of these creatures are spawn directly from the wood patterns themselves while others may be inspired from various elements in nature or even personal experiences. These anthropomorphized fish-creatures that I invent are extensions of ourselves: our pasts, our choices, our individualities. Each is left untitled to allow a higher level of personal connection for each viewer.
